WebJun 3, 2024 · Summary: To study the brain “in action,” researchers use a specialized form of brain imaging known as task-based functional MRI (task-fMRI), which shows how the … The image shown is the result of the simplest kind of fMRI experiment. While lying in the MRI scanner the subject watched a screen which alternated between showing a visual stimulus and being dark every 30 second. Meanwhile the MRI scanner tracked the signal throughout the brain. Accidents and lesioning research in the 19th century provided the first evidence that complex cognitive processes (e.g. language) depend on different regions of the brain.
